Output 618a756da1e9c7d017ca6a7de65e19bd48b96f9fe5c619a40e7b9c54ac41ffca:1

value
161554118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38c30a57f1bd13eb58516c42677c8a34e24bb54c OP_EQUAL
address
36s9QvxasHKzj9Y6FU2Kwod1GKnWHjfJtx
transaction
618a756da1e9c7d017ca6a7de65e19bd48b96f9fe5c619a40e7b9c54ac41ffca
confirmations
330340
spent
true